Speaking of Kiffin, did you see where he apparently said that Tua was leaving Bama if they hadn't played him last night?
ETA:
Link to full article with vid of interview
ETA:
quote:
“I think that’s a great question,” Kiffin said on the future of Jalen Hurts at Alabama. “If this second half doesn’t flip like this, and Alabama is moving the ball and doesn’t change [quarterbacks], people that really know what’s going on would tell you that Tua was leaving. Because Tua thought that he should be the starting quarterback and had outperformed him in practice and Coach never gave him an opportunity.
“How this second half played out changes college football, because Tua is going to be one of the best quarterbacks in college football.”
Patrick cut Kiffin off as he started gushing about Tagovailoa with comparisons to Steve Young, making sure to clarify that he meant Tagovailoa would have transferred from Alabama had he not played in the national title game.
“No doubt.”
